Popular Tools and What They Do
To maximize the magic of BPM, businesses rely on various tools, each bringing its unique touch:
- AgilePoint: Like a wizard in a video game, it offers customized solutions, leveraging AI for results that fit just right.
- Appian: The Swiss Army knife of BPM tools—versatile and efficient, with robust AI support.
- Bizagi: It’s all about creating without coding, akin to crafting a website with the simplicity of drag-and-drop.
- iGrafx: As if flying a simulator, test your business processes before taking significant actions.
- Kissflow: Designed for everyone, regardless of tech skills, like editing photos with an intuitive app.
